You can get many great craft supplies through Etsy. This site offers items for sale from individuals. In addition to purchasing your supplies, this site offers you a chance to sell your projects. The site is ideal when you need vintage media for craft projects.

To create a cute bird feeding alongside your children, use some pine cones and peanut butter. When the peanut butter still has stickiness, roll it all around in bird seeds. The seeds adhere to the cone, even after drying, so if you hang it from a tree with a string, then you can just enjoy watching birds feast in your yard.
